1 cod filets (or your favorite white fish)
2 tablespoons butter or 2 tablespoons margarine
1⁄2 cup onion, finely chopped
1⁄2 cup green pepper, finely chopped
1 tablespoon flour
1 teaspoon brown sugar
1⁄2 teaspoon dried marjoram
1⁄4 teaspoon dried thyme
1 (15 ounce) can diced tomatoes with juice (I like whole, peeled canned tomatoes and I crush them by hand)
Here's how to make it:
Preheat your over to 400 degrees.
Spray a baking dish with non-stick spray.
Melt butter in a pan over medium heat.
Add onion and pepper and saute until softened.
Stir in flour, brown sugar, herbs, salt and pepper to taste, and combine well.
Gradually stir in tomatoes with juice.
Bring sauce to a boil.
Keep stiring until sauce has slightly thickened.
Place fish fillets in baking dish and top with the sauce.
Place dish in oven and bake for 12-15 minutes or until fish is cooked through and flakes easily.
